
Christmas & New Year Holidays 2025/2026: Ministry of Transportation Implements Contraflow, Port Diversions, and Truck Restrictions
JAKARTA – The Ministry of Transportation (Kemenhub), the National Police Traffic Corps (Korlantas Polri), and the Ministry of Public Works and Housing (PUPR) have issued a Joint Decree (SKB) to regulate traffic during the 2025 Christmas and 2026 New Year (Nataru) transport period. The policy focuses on traffic engineering measures and restrictions on heavy vehicles.
Key Traffic Management Measures
Contraflow: Implemented on the Jakarta–Cikampek (Japek) Toll Road (KM 47–KM 70) and the Jagorawi Toll Road (KM 21–KM 8). A detailed contraflow schedule has been prepared for both the outbound and return holiday traffic periods.
One-Way: A one-way traffic system will be applied situationally based on police discretion.
Project Suspension: All construction projects on toll roads must be temporarily halted from December 16, 2025 to January 4, 2026.
Freight Transport Restrictions
Operational restrictions apply to freight vehicles with three or more axles.
Restrictions also apply on major non-toll roads, with exceptions for vehicles transporting fuel (BBM/BBG) and essential goods, provided they carry official cargo documents.
Port Traffic Diversions
To reduce congestion, heavy vehicles (Class II and above) heading to Sumatra will be diverted from Merak Port to supporting ports, namely Ciwandan and BBJ Bojonegara.
The public is advised to book ferry tickets through Ferizy and comply with all traffic regulations to ensure smooth and safe travel.
